The Bullet Legacy, Now With 650 Power
The Bullet is one of the longest-running motorcycle nameplates in history. Simple. Honest. Mechanical. Royal Enfield has preserved that essence while giving the Bullet something American riders have long wanted — the proven 650 platform.

By pairing classic Bullet styling with a larger-displacement engine, Royal Enfield bridges generations. The result is a bike that still looks timeless but delivers smoother power, improved highway comfort, and greater versatility for modern roads.
Classic Design, Thoughtfully Updated
Visually, the Bullet 650 remains unmistakable. Teardrop fuel tank. Minimal bodywork. Upright stance. It’s retro in the best possible way.

Underneath, however, the updates matter:
Refined chassis tuned for stability
Improved braking performance
Modern suspension calibration
Updated lighting and electronics while retaining a classic feel
Royal Enfield has been careful not to overdo it. The Bullet 650 isn’t chasing trends — it’s honoring a legacy while quietly improving the ride.
